Designed in conjunction with icare and Griffith University, the free Respect & Resilience Program supports employers and workers to minimise the impact of customer misbehaviour. The program teaches front line workers to identify the signs of misbehaviour early and provides the skills to prevent someone escalating to those higher levels.

These free online resources have been developed by Beyond Blue to increase understanding of mental health in the workplace and provide practical strategies to support you. Each resource takes up to 20 minutes to complete and can be used on desktop computers, laptops, and tablets. Some of the resources are also Sharable Content Object Reference Model (SCORM) which means they can be imported into your Learning Management System (LMS) if you have one.
